Feature Summary



  • Digital Electronics: Principles and Applications presents gates, circuits and other devices as sub-systems within larger digital system applications.

  • Concepts build from section to section and chapter to chapter, with self-tests at regular intervals and review questions at the end of each chapter.

  • Experiments Manual for Digital Electronics: Principles and Applications correlates with the text and helps students gain practical, hands-on experience, troubleshooting skills, and exposure to software simulation techniques.

  • The Online Learning Center contains classroom instructor PowerPoint presentations for every chapter, EZ-Test electronic test generator and questions, solutions to all textbook and Experiments Manual questions and activities, supplemental PowerPoint presentations, and more.

  • The Online Learning Center also contains materials for students including a self-grading practice text program for every chapter, soldering, and breadboarding presentations, and more.
